Machine Learning Programmer _ Content Creation TG

4 weeks ago


Montreal, Canada Ubisoft Full time

Job Description

The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.

Main responsibilities:

Designing and developing machine learning systems and schemes based on the business requirements and objectives. Write ML algorithms and train models. Create tools to support and integrate the ML models inside a multi-process pipeline. Identifying, preparing, and analyzing data for training and testing purposes. Conducting experiments, performing statistical analysis, and fine-tuning models. Enhancing the existing machine learning libraries and frameworks. Collaborating with data science team, research team and other stakeholders.

Other responsibilities:

Creating proof of concepts, that can require model training, fine tuning, experimenting with different techniques and models. Optimizing existing models and solutions for improved performance, scalability, and efficiency. Adapting and improving models’ usage, facilitating tools usage, and adapting these to users needs. Collaborating with cross-functional teams to define project requirements and objectives. Conducting research to stay up to date with the latest advancements. Documentation, presentations, and knowledge sharing to communicate complex AI concepts to both technical and non-technical collaborators.

Qualifications

Education:

Bachelor’s degree in computer science or computer engineering or equivalent. Master in AI or Machine Learning is an asset.

Relevant experience:

Minimum 5 years’ experience in AI/ML.

Skills:

A deep knowledge of Machine Learning and deep learning fundamentals. Proficient in Python and have experience with libraries and frameworks such as PyTorch, scikit-learn, pandas, FastApi. A good knowledge of cloud-based platforms is an asset. A good knowledge of Database products is an asset.

  • Montreal, Canada Ubisoft Full time

    Job D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main...


  • Montreal, Canada Ubisoft Entertainment Full time

    Full-timeFlexible Working Organization: HybridJob D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main...


  • Montreal, Quebec, Canada Ubisoft Entertainment Full time

    Full-timeFlexible Working Organization: HybridJob D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our...


  • Montreal, Canada Ubisoft Entertainment Full time

    Full-timeFlexible Working Organization: HybridJob DescriptionThe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our...


  • Montreal, Canada Ubisoft Entertainment Full time

    The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main responsibilities:Designing and...


  • Montreal, Canada Ubisoft Entertainment Full time

    The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in delivering our ambitious roadmap.Main responsibilities:Designing and...


  • Montreal, Canada Ubisoft Full time

    JOB DESCRIPTION The Content Creation Technology Group (CCTG) is looking for a Senior AI/ML Programmer who will contribute to the development of applications in the domains of Generative AI and ML bots. The Senior AI/ML Programmer will bring best practices and design principles to assist the team in


  • Montreal, Canada Ubisoft Full time

    Job Description As an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job Description As an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ionAs an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ionAs an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ionAs an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ionAs an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Job DescriptionAs an animation programmer, you will be part of a character animation tools development team in the Content Creation Technology Group (CCTG). You’ll design and create innovative animation IK solutions in collaboration with game productions. You'll be responsible for building systems and tools that will help your colleagues create fun,...


  • Montreal, Canada Ubisoft Full time

    Description du posteLe Groupe Technologique de Création de Contenu (CCTG) est à la recherche d'un programmeur senior IA/ML qui contribuera au développement d'applications dans les domaines de l'IA générative et des robots ML. Le programmeur senior IA/ML apportera les meilleures pratiques et principes de conception pour aider l'équipe à livrer notre...


  • Montreal, Canada Ubisoft Full time

    Description du poste Le Groupe Technologique de Création de Contenu (CCTG) est à la recherche d'un programmeur senior IA/ML qui contribuera au développement d'applications dans les domaines de l'IA générative et des robots ML. Le programmeur senior IA/ML apportera les meilleures pratiques et principes de conception pour aider l'équipe à livrer...


  • Montreal, Canada Ubisoft Full time

    Description du posteLe Groupe Technologique de Création de Contenu (CCTG) est à la recherche d'un programmeur senior IA/ML qui contribuera au développement d'applications dans les domaines de l'IA générative et des robots ML. Le programmeur senior IA/ML apportera les meilleures pratiques et principes de conception pour aider l'équipe à livrer notre...